COMMERCE BUSINESS DAILY ISSUE OF FEBRUARY 8,1999 PSA#2278Commander (VPL), U.S. Coast Guard, Maintenance & Logistics Command
Atlantic, 300 East Main Street, Suite 600, Norfolk, VA 23510-9102 J -- DRYDOCK REPAIRS TO USCGC SCIOTO (WLR-65504) SOL
DTCG80-99-B-3FC789 DUE 040199 POC Contact Ms. Cindy Floyd, Contract
Specialist, (757) 628-4653, Ms. Vanessa A. Nemara, Contract Officer,
(757) 628-4634 Provide all labor, material, and equipment necessary to
perform Drydock repairs including, but not limited to the following
Items: 1) Welding Repairs, 2) Preserve potable Water Tank(s), 3)
Preserve Spud and Spud Well On Tender and Barge, 4) Remove, Inspect,
Repair, and Reninstall Tail Shafts, 5) Fabricate Shaft, 6) Renew
Water-Lubricated Shaft Bearings, 7) Renew Shaft Sleeves, 8) Renew Shaft
Strut Barrel, 9) Remove and Reinstall Propellers, 10) Perform propeller
Minor Repair and Reconditioning, 11) Remove, Inspect, Reinstall
Steering Rudder Assemblies, 12) Renew Rudder Lower Bearing Trunk, 13)
Renew Upper Bearing Housing and Upper Bearing Housing Support, 14)
Clean and Test Grid Coolers, 15) Install Potable Water Shore Tie
Connection (ShipAlt No. 65501(A)-43), 16) Overhaul and Test Valves, 17)
Clean and Inspect Diesel Fuel Tanks, 18) Inspect, Overhaul and Test
Barge Boat Davit, 19) Overhaul Barge hydraulic Capstan, 20) Inspect,
Overhaul and Test Allied ATON Crane, 21) Fabricate and Install New
Sewage Tank, 22) Inspect Various Deck Fittings, 23) Preserve Various
Compartments, 24) Preserve Barge Buoy Deck, 25) Preserve Underwater
Body, 26) Preserve Freeboard, 27) Ultrasonic Testing, 28) Provide
Temporary Logistics, and 29) Routine Drydocking. Vessel availability
schedule will be 07 June 1999 for 54 calendar days. There will be a
nonrefundable charge of $100.00 in the form of a certified check or
money order payable to the U.S. Coast Guard for requested drawings.
Plans and specifications will be issued on or after 01 March 1999. All
